Top Bookkeeping Tips for Small Businesses
- Mark Habencius
- Oct 1, 2025
- 6 min read
Running a small business is no small feat. From managing customers to keeping track of inventory, the list of tasks can feel endless. One of the most crucial aspects of running a business is bookkeeping. Good bookkeeping helps you understand your financial health, make informed decisions, and ensure compliance with tax regulations. In this post, we will explore some top bookkeeping tips that can help small business owners stay organized and efficient.
Understand the Basics of Bookkeeping
Before diving into specific tips, it is essential to understand what bookkeeping entails. Bookkeeping is the process of recording financial transactions. This includes sales, purchases, receipts, and payments.
Having a solid grasp of these basics will help you manage your finances better.
Here are some key components of bookkeeping:
Accounts Receivable: Money owed to you by customers.
Accounts Payable: Money you owe to suppliers.
General Ledger: A complete record of all financial transactions.
Bank Reconciliation: Comparing your records with bank statements to ensure accuracy.
Understanding these terms will set a strong foundation for your bookkeeping practices.
Choose the Right Bookkeeping Method
There are two primary methods of bookkeeping: cash basis and accrual basis.
Cash Basis: You record income and expenses when cash changes hands. This method is simpler and often preferred by small businesses.
Accrual Basis: You record income and expenses when they are earned or incurred, regardless of when cash is exchanged. This method provides a more accurate picture of your financial situation.
Choosing the right method depends on your business needs. If you are just starting, the cash basis may be easier to manage.
Keep Personal and Business Finances Separate
One of the most common mistakes small business owners make is mixing personal and business finances.
To avoid confusion and potential legal issues, open a separate bank account for your business. This will make tracking expenses and income much easier.
Additionally, using a dedicated credit card for business expenses can help you keep everything organized.
Use Accounting Software
In today's digital age, there are many accounting software options available. Using software can simplify your bookkeeping process significantly.
Some popular options include:
QuickBooks: Great for small businesses, offering various features for invoicing, payroll, and reporting.
Xero: Known for its user-friendly interface and strong customer support.
FreshBooks: Ideal for service-based businesses, focusing on invoicing and time tracking.
Investing in accounting software can save you time and reduce errors.
Keep Track of Receipts
Receipts are essential for accurate bookkeeping. They provide proof of your expenses and are necessary for tax deductions.
Here are some tips for managing receipts:
Use a Receipt Scanner: Scan and save your receipts digitally. This reduces clutter and makes it easier to find them later.
Organize by Category: Sort receipts into categories such as travel, supplies, and meals. This will make it easier when it comes time to file taxes.
Set a Regular Schedule: Dedicate time each week or month to organize and review your receipts. This will help you stay on top of your finances.
Reconcile Your Accounts Regularly
Regular reconciliation of your accounts is vital for accurate bookkeeping. This process involves comparing your financial records with bank statements to ensure everything matches.
Here are some steps to follow:
Gather Your Records: Collect your bank statements and financial records.
Compare Transactions: Check each transaction in your records against your bank statement.
Identify Discrepancies: If you find any differences, investigate them immediately.
Make Adjustments: Update your records as needed to ensure accuracy.
By reconciling your accounts regularly, you can catch errors early and maintain accurate financial records.
Keep an Eye on Cash Flow
Cash flow is the lifeblood of any business. It refers to the money coming in and going out of your business.
To manage cash flow effectively, consider the following tips:
Create a Cash Flow Forecast: Estimate your cash inflows and outflows for the upcoming months. This will help you anticipate any shortfalls.
Monitor Receivables: Keep track of outstanding invoices and follow up with customers who are late on payments.
Control Expenses: Regularly review your expenses and look for areas where you can cut costs.
By keeping a close eye on your cash flow, you can make informed decisions and avoid financial pitfalls.
Stay Compliant with Tax Regulations
Tax compliance is crucial for small businesses. Failing to comply can lead to penalties and fines.
Here are some tips to ensure you stay compliant:
Know Your Tax Obligations: Understand what taxes you need to pay, including income tax, sales tax, and payroll tax.
Keep Accurate Records: Maintain detailed records of all financial transactions. This will make tax filing easier and more accurate.
Consult a Tax Professional: If you are unsure about your tax obligations, consider consulting a tax professional. They can provide valuable guidance and help you avoid costly mistakes.
Regularly Review Financial Reports
Financial reports provide valuable insights into your business's performance. Regularly reviewing these reports can help you make informed decisions.
Key reports to consider include:
Profit and Loss Statement: Shows your revenue, expenses, and profit over a specific period.
Balance Sheet: Provides a snapshot of your assets, liabilities, and equity at a specific point in time.
Cash Flow Statement: Details the cash inflows and outflows over a specific period.
By regularly reviewing these reports, you can identify trends, spot potential issues, and make strategic decisions for your business.
Educate Yourself on Bookkeeping Best Practices
Staying informed about bookkeeping best practices is essential for small business owners.
Consider the following ways to enhance your knowledge:
Attend Workshops: Look for local workshops or online courses focused on bookkeeping and accounting.
Read Books and Articles: There are many resources available that cover bookkeeping topics in detail.
Join Online Forums: Engage with other small business owners in online forums to share tips and experiences.
By continuously educating yourself, you can improve your bookkeeping skills and better manage your business finances.
Seek Professional Help When Needed
While many small business owners handle their bookkeeping themselves, there may come a time when you need professional help.
Consider hiring a bookkeeper or accountant if:
You are overwhelmed with financial tasks.
You want to focus on growing your business rather than managing finances.
You need assistance with tax preparation and compliance.
Hiring a professional can save you time and ensure your financial records are accurate.
Embrace Technology for Efficiency
Technology can significantly enhance your bookkeeping process.
Consider using tools and apps that can streamline your financial management.
For example:
Expense Tracking Apps: Use apps like Expensify or Receipt Bank to track expenses on the go.
Invoicing Software: Automate your invoicing process with tools like Invoice Ninja or Zoho Invoice.
Cloud Storage: Store your financial documents in the cloud for easy access and backup.
By embracing technology, you can improve efficiency and reduce the risk of errors in your bookkeeping.
Stay Organized
Organization is key to effective bookkeeping.
Here are some tips to help you stay organized:
Create a Filing System: Develop a system for organizing your financial documents, both physical and digital.
Use Labels: Clearly label folders and files to make it easy to find what you need.
Set Reminders: Use calendar reminders to keep track of important deadlines, such as tax filing dates.
By staying organized, you can save time and reduce stress when managing your finances.
Keep Learning and Adapting
The world of bookkeeping is constantly evolving.
Stay open to learning new techniques and adapting your practices as needed.
Consider the following:
Stay Updated on Regulations: Tax laws and regulations can change, so it is essential to stay informed.
Seek Feedback: Ask for feedback from your accountant or bookkeeper to identify areas for improvement.
Experiment with New Tools: Don’t be afraid to try new software or tools that may enhance your bookkeeping process.
By keeping a growth mindset, you can continuously improve your bookkeeping practices and support your business's success.
Final Thoughts
Effective bookkeeping is essential for the success of any small business. By implementing these tips, you can streamline your financial management, stay organized, and make informed decisions.
Remember, good bookkeeping is not just about keeping records; it is about understanding your business's financial health and planning for the future.
With the right practices in place, you can focus on what you do best—growing your business.



Comments